Gomphrena and Cherry Bomb Pepper Physical Information

Gomphrena and Cherry Bomb Pepper physical information is very important for comparison. Gomphrena height is 30.40 cm and width 30.50 cm whereas Cherry Bomb Pepper height is 61.00 cm and width 61.00 cm. The color specification of Gomphrena and Cherry Bomb Pepper are as follows:

  • Gomphrena flower color: White, Purple, Pink and Magenta

  • Gomphrena leaf color: Green

  • Cherry Bomb Pepper flower color: White

  • Cherry Bomb Pepper leaf color: Dark Green
